    Chuck Baldwin once said:

    It seems that every time someone such as myself attempts to encourage our Christian brothers and sisters to resist an unconstitutional or otherwise reprehensible government policy, we hear the retort, "What about Romans Chapter 13? We Christians must submit to government. Any government. Read your Bible, and leave me alone." Or words to that effect.

    Many historians have documented how the Nazi regime in Germany weaponized Romans 13 to cement strong domestic support for the Third Reich.

    Although I once read a history of MI6, the British Secret Intelligence Service, that detailed how they vetted potential double agents of the Nazi regime. The most accurate predictor of how good they would be was if they were a member of the Evangelical German Protestant Church. So how does that jibe with Romans 13?
